DISH taps Rovi for TV voice controls

US pay TV provider DISH has partnered with Rovi to add the latter’s Conversation Services’ spoken-voice interface to a portfolio of it products. 

During 2015, DISH will add the voice technology into its DISH Explorer second-screen app for iPad, Hopper Voice remote, and its DISH Anywhere mobile app, allowing subscribers to use voice search to find live, recorded or on-demand TV shows and movies.

“Consumers seek a television experience that gets them to their shows with minimal hassle,” said Vivek Khemka, senior vice president of product management at DISH.

“DISH is committed to implementing the best technology for our customers, and we believe the introduction of voice recognition will provide them with a more intuitive search experience.”

Daren Gill, vice president of products, advanced search and recommendations at Rovi, added: “Given the scale of DISH’s subscriber base, we hope to significantly shift the public perception of how people can discover and navigate content with next-gen semantic technologies in ways that have not been possible before.”
